volume problem

Have an 06 UC with the stock HK radio. Problem is when increasing the volume, once I reach halfway the volume does not increase any more. The number of bars increase on the display, but the sound does not get any louder than what is at the half way point.
Any suggestions?
 
Have you changed out the speakers by chance to a different ohm value. Example, they were 4 ohm from the factory and now they are six ohm? Also, once the speakers reach max volume, if you increase the level (bars), does the sound get distorted.
 
no, have not changed out speakers, they are original as far as I can tell. No, there is not any change in distortion, the volume increases until you reach the halfway point, then no more increase in volume..even though the display shows there is half more volume to go. The bars increase but no increase in volume.
 
Has it always done it or is it something new. In reality, once the volume reaches a max, any added control volume position should force the amp to clip and produce distortion. I have read that firmware upgrades are common and easy to do.

I would make sure I had the latest firmware loaded to the radio before I did anything hardware wise because a firmware issue could cause that.
Others will chime in, I am sure.
 
If you want to try a software upgrade, go to the HD website and type 'Harmon Kardon' in the search box, then find the upgrade instructions to burn a disc. The only trick to it is to burn the disc at the slowest possible speed your computer will burn one. You can look in the forums help section, there's several articles. I don't think the upgrade deals with volume problems, but might be worth trying.
